PNEUMOTACH AIRFLOW TRANSDUCERS
TSD137 SERIES FOR MP150/MP100 SYSTEM
SS46L-SS52L SERIES FOR MP3X AND MP45 SYSTEM
RX137 SERIES REPLACEMENT FLOW HEADS
The TSD137/
SS46L-SS52L series pneumotachs
can be used to perform a variety
of small animal
and human pulmonary measurements relating to
airflow, lung volume and expired gas analysis.
These pneumotach transducers consist of a low
flow, pneumotach airflow head (RX137B through
RX137H and SS46L through SS52L) coupled to a
precision, highly sensitive, differential pressure
transducer (TSD160A or SS40L).
The pneumotachs will connect directly to a
breathing circuit or plethysmogram chamber. For airflow and lung volume measurements, connect a short airflow
cannula to the RX137 series flow head. All pneumotachs are equipped with an internal heating element and
AC137A 6-volt power supply.

RX137 SERIES REPLACEMENT AIRFLOW HEADS (SHOWN ABOVE)
For TSD137 & SS46L-SS52L Series Pneumotachs
The RX137 series are airflow heads for the TSD137 a
nd SS46L-52L series pneumotach transducers. The RX137
heads can be mixed and matched with any of th
e TSD137 and SS46L-SS52L series pneumotachs. Switching one
head for another when using a single pneumotach can accommodate a wide range in flows. RX137 heads connect
to the TSD160A or SS40L differential pressure transducer via standard 3mm or 4mm ID tubing. Multiple RX137
heads help eliminate equipment downtime during cleaning procedures.
PNEUMOTACH AIRFLOW TRANSDUCER CALIBRATION
Connect tubing between the calibration syringe and the transducer, then follow the procedure for
TSD117/SS11LA but move the calibration syringe plunger at a reduced velocity due to the very high sensitivity to
flow of the TSD137/SS46L-SS52L series. Each of the TSD137/SS46L-SS52L series is factory calibrated to a
known flow level, as indicated on the transducer.
FLOW HEAD CLEANING & DISINFECTION
IMPOR
TANT:
RX137 series airflow heads are manufactured with a very thin layer of synthetic resin, so they should
never be cleaned with an organic solvent. We recommend cleaners such as Hydro-Merfen at the
concentration used for medical material, or Gluterex.
Before using the airflow head, be sure it is dry.
Never heat the airflow head higher than 50 C.
1. Submerge the airflow head in a disinfectant solution for approximately one hour.
2. Rinse the airflow head with distilled or de-mineralized water.
3. Use compressed air or another compressed gas [pressure up to 5kg / cm2 (5 bar)] to drive any
remaining water out of the airflow head.
4. Allow the airflow head to dry completely in ambient air (or continue using compressed air if time
requires it).
